Stavroula Katholos' Obituary
Stavroula Katholos, born on June 29, 1935, in Sparta, Greece, passed away peacefully surrounded by love on Friday, March 20, 2026.
She was the beloved wife of the late Haralambos Katholos, with whom she shared 55 beautiful years of marriage rooted in devotion, strength, and unwavering love.
Stavroula was a deeply loving and devoted mother to her three daughters, Katherine Turner (Bill Reilly), Georgia (Thomas) Queri, and Elaine (Jeff) Katholos-Jungsten, and a cherished mother-in-law. She was a proud and adoring grandmother (Yia Yia) to her four grandchildren, Brandon Turner, Victoria Turner, Olivia Queri and A.J. Queri who brought her immense joy and light. She is also survived by her beloved brother, James (Theodora) Eliopoulos and a sister-in-law, Kalliopi Katholos along with several nieces and nephews.
Stavroula was predeceased by her dear brother, Louis Eliopoulos.
She was an incredible woman with the kindest heart. Selfless, warm, and full of love for her family and everyone around her. She connected with people through food whether cooking for customers at Harry’s Restaurant, preparing her grandchildren’s favorite meals, or lovingly making Greek desserts for friends, neighbors, and the doctors who cared for her. Food was her language of connection, generosity, and love.
Stavroula held a deep love for her faith and church community, where she found connection, purpose, and friendship throughout her life.
Her legacy lives on in the love she gave so freely, the family she raised, and the many lives she touched.
She will be deeply missed and forever loved.
In keeping with Stavroula’s wishes, funeral services will be private. She will be laid to rest beside her husband, Haralambos in Oakwood Cemetery.
